MCP Agent Mail

A mail-like coordination layer for coding agents, exposed as an HTTP-only FastMCP server. Gives agents memorable identities, an inbox/outbox, searchable message history, and voluntary file reservation "leases" to avoid stepping on each other.

Think of it as asynchronous email + directory + change-intent signaling for your agents, backed by Git (for human-auditable artifacts) and SQLite (for indexing and queries).

Why Agent Mail Exists

Modern projects often run multiple coding agents at once. Without coordination, agents:

  • Overwrite each other's edits or panic on unexpected diffs
  • Miss critical context from parallel workstreams
  • Require humans to "liaison" messages across tools

Agent Mail provides:

  • Identities: Memorable adjective+noun names (e.g., "GreenCastle", "BlueLake")
  • Messaging: GitHub-Flavored Markdown with threading, importance levels, and acknowledgments
  • File Reservations: Advisory leases on files/globs to signal editing intent
  • Search: FTS5 full-text search across message history
  • Audit Trail: Every message and reservation is committed to Git

Starting the Server

# Quick start (alias added during installation)
am

# Or manually
cd ~/projects/mcp_agent_mail && ./scripts/run_server_with_token.sh

# Check server health
curl http://127.0.0.1:8765/health/liveness

Default: http://127.0.0.1:8765. Change port with uv run python -m mcp_agent_mail.cli config set-port 9000.


Critical Concept: project_key

The project_key is the absolute path to your working directory. This is the canonical identifier for a project.

# Two agents in the SAME directory = SAME project
Agent A in /data/projects/backend → project_key="/data/projects/backend"
Agent B in /data/projects/backend → project_key="/data/projects/backend"
# They share the same mailbox, file reservations, and coordination

# Two agents in DIFFERENT directories = DIFFERENT projects
Agent A in /data/projects/backend  → project_key="/data/projects/backend"
Agent B in /data/projects/frontend → project_key="/data/projects/frontend"
# They need explicit contact requests to message each other

Macros vs Granular Tools

Prefer macros when you want speed or are on a smaller model:

MacroWhat It Does
macro_start_sessionEnsures project → registers agent → optional file reservations → fetches inbox
macro_prepare_threadRegisters agent → summarizes thread → fetches inbox context
macro_file_reservation_cycleReserves paths → optional auto-release after work
macro_contact_handshakeRequests contact → auto-accepts → sends welcome message

Use granular tools when you need explicit control over each step.

Example Agent Workflow

# 1. Start session (one call does everything)
result = macro_start_session(
    human_key="/data/projects/backend",
    program="claude-code",
    model="opus-4.5",
    task_description="Implementing auth module"
)
agent_name = result["agent"]["name"]  # e.g., "GreenCastle"
project_key = result["project"]["human_key"]

# 2. Check inbox for context
for msg in result["inbox"]:
    if msg["importance"] in ["high", "urgent"]:
        acknowledge_message(project_key, agent_name, msg["id"])

# 3. Reserve files before editing
file_reservation_paths(
    project_key, agent_name,
    paths=["src/auth/**/*.ts"],
    ttl_seconds=3600,
    exclusive=True,
    reason="bd-123"  # Link to Beads task
)

# 4. Do work, send progress updates
send_message(
    project_key, agent_name,
    to=["BlueLake"],
    subject="[bd-123] Auth module progress",
    body_md="Completed login flow. Starting session management.",
    thread_id="bd-123"
)

# 5. Release reservations when done
release_file_reservations(project_key, agent_name)

Cross-Project Coordination

When repos are separate (e.g., frontend and backend):

Option A: Single project bus

  • Register both agents under the same project_key
  • Keep reservation patterns specific: frontend/** vs backend/**

Option B: Separate projects with contact links

# Backend agent requests contact
request_contact(
    project_key="/data/projects/backend",
    from_agent="GreenCastle",
    to_agent="BlueLake",
    to_project="/data/projects/frontend",
    reason="API contract coordination"
)

# Frontend agent accepts
respond_contact(
    project_key="/data/projects/frontend",
    to_agent="BlueLake",
    from_agent="GreenCastle",
    from_project="/data/projects/backend",
    accept=True
)

# Now they can message each other

Pre-Commit Guard

The optional pre-commit guard blocks commits that touch files reserved by other agents:

# Install guard into your code repo
mcp-agent-mail guard install /data/projects/backend /data/projects/backend

# Check guard status
mcp-agent-mail guard status /data/projects/backend

# Uninstall
mcp-agent-mail guard uninstall /data/projects/backend

Requirements:

  • Set AGENT_NAME environment variable so the guard knows who you are
  • File reservations must be active (not expired)

Bypass (use sparingly):

AGENT_MAIL_BYPASS=1 git commit -m "..."
# Or: AGENT_MAIL_GUARD_MODE=warn (advisory mode, doesn't block)

Build Slots (Long-Running Tasks)

For dev servers, watchers, or builds that hold resources:

# Acquire a slot
acquire_build_slot(project_key, agent_name, "frontend-build", ttl_seconds=3600, exclusive=True)

# Renew during long runs
renew_build_slot(project_key, agent_name, "frontend-build", extend_seconds=1800)

# Release when done
release_build_slot(project_key, agent_name, "frontend-build")

CLI helper:

mcp-agent-mail am-run frontend-build -- npm run dev

Product Bus (Multi-Repo Coordination)

Group multiple repos under a single "product" for cross-project search and inbox:

# Create a product
mcp-agent-mail products ensure MyProduct --name "My Product"

# Link repos
mcp-agent-mail products link MyProduct /data/projects/backend
mcp-agent-mail products link MyProduct /data/projects/frontend

# Product-wide search
mcp-agent-mail products search MyProduct "urgent AND deploy" --limit 50

# Product-wide inbox
mcp-agent-mail products inbox MyProduct BlueLake --urgent-only

# Product-wide thread summary
mcp-agent-mail products summarize-thread MyProduct "bd-123"

Human Overseer

Click "Send Message" in any project view to send messages as HumanOverseer:

  • Messages include a preamble instructing agents to pause and prioritize
  • Bypasses contact policies
  • Marked as high importance automatically

Static Mailbox Export

Export mailboxes as portable, read-only HTML bundles:

# Interactive wizard (easiest)
uv run python -m mcp_agent_mail.cli share wizard

# Manual export
uv run python -m mcp_agent_mail.cli share export --output ./bundle

# Preview locally
uv run python -m mcp_agent_mail.cli share preview ./bundle --port 9000

# Verify integrity
uv run python -m mcp_agent_mail.cli share verify ./bundle

Features:

  • Self-contained HTML viewer with FTS5 search
  • Ed25519 signing for tamper-evident distribution
  • Optional age encryption for confidential archives
  • Deploy to GitHub Pages or Cloudflare Pages

Integration with Beads

Beads (bd) owns task status/priority; Agent Mail owns conversations and audit trails.

Conventions:

  • Use Beads issue ID as Mail thread_id: send_message(..., thread_id="bd-123")
  • Prefix subjects: [bd-123] Starting auth refactor
  • Include issue ID in file reservation reason: file_reservation_paths(..., reason="bd-123")

Typical flow:

# 1. Pick ready work
bd ready --json

# 2. Reserve files
file_reservation_paths(project_key, agent_name, ["src/**"], reason="bd-123")

# 3. Announce start
send_message(..., thread_id="bd-123", subject="[bd-123] Starting work")

# 4. Complete
bd close bd-123 --reason "Completed"
release_file_reservations(project_key, agent_name)

Search Syntax (FTS5)

"exact phrase"           # Phrase search
prefix*                   # Prefix match
term1 AND term2           # Boolean AND
term1 OR term2            # Boolean OR
term1 NOT term2           # Exclusion
subject:login             # Field-specific
body:"build plan"         # Field-specific phrase

Configuration Variables

VariableDefaultDescription
STORAGE_ROOT~/.mcp_agent_mail_git_mailbox_repoRoot for project repos and SQLite
HTTP_HOST127.0.0.1Bind host
HTTP_PORT8765Bind port
HTTP_BEARER_TOKENStatic bearer token for auth
HTTP_ALLOW_LOCALHOST_UNAUTHENTICATEDtrueAllow localhost without auth
LLM_ENABLEDtrueEnable LLM for summaries
LLM_DEFAULT_MODELgpt-5-miniDefault model for summaries
CONTACT_ENFORCEMENT_ENABLEDtrueEnforce contact policies
FILE_RESERVATIONS_ENFORCEMENT_ENABLEDtrueBlock messages on conflicts
AGENT_NAME_ENFORCEMENT_MODEcoercestrict, coerce, always_auto

Troubleshooting

IssueSolution
"sender_name not registered"Call register_agent or macro_start_session first
"from_agent not registered"Check project_key matches the agent's project
"FILE_RESERVATION_CONFLICT"Adjust patterns, wait for expiry, or use non-exclusive
Pre-commit blocks commitsSet AGENT_NAME, or use AGENT_MAIL_BYPASS=1
Inbox empty but messages existCheck since_ts, limit; verify recipient names match exactly
